President Kovind says, the government is promoting digital India

<span style="color: #222222;">Inaugurating the 29th Accountants General conference in New Delhi today, President Ram Nath Kovind said, the government is making great strides in ushering in digital India.</span><br />'' <br />'' <br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">The President today called for introspection and deliberations on the need to further promoting accountability, transparency and good governance.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;"> </span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">Mr Kovind was speaking after inaugurating the two-day Accountants General conference in New Delhi today. The President said, the institution of the Comptroller and Auditor General plays a vital role in ensuring transparency of operations and promoting good governance.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;"> </span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">He said, the 150 year-old institution has lived up to the country's expectations and has graduated from promoting accountability through accounts to ensuring that the right things are done in the right and least expensive ways. Mr Kovind said, the broad mandate and range of audit assignments, transactions and operations as well as the expertise required for a thorough analysis is challenging and the institution has always risen to the occasion. The theme of this year's conference is auditing and accounting in a digital era.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;"> </span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">The Accountants General from all over the country are participating in the two-day conference organised by the Comptroller and Auditor General of India. The meet deliberates on adopting most modern audit techniques to further improve audit effectiveness and enhance accountability in public spending.</span><br />''
